The legendary New Orleans saxophonist and educatorEdward ‘Kidd" Jordan brings his Trio, featuring William Parker (bass) and Hamid Drake (drums), for an incendiary evening of improvised music. A revered educator at Southern University, Jordan's resume includes records and performances with Ray Charles, Ornette Coleman, Ellis Marsalis and Cecil Taylor. The indefatigable 73 year old visionary was made Knight (Chevalier) of the Ordre des Arts et des Lettres by the French Ministry of Culture in 1985, and honored with a Lifetime Achievement Award in June at the Vision Festival in New York.
